Reporting to the Accounts Receivable Team Leader, you’ll play a key role in supporting the finance team with day-to-day accounts receivable duties. Your focus will be on ensuring accurate and timely processing of transactions while managing stakeholders across multiple sites. Attention to detail and strong communication skills will be essential to maintaining efficiency and service quality.
- Processing and reconciling customer payments
- Allocating receipts accurately across multiple accounts
- Preparing and issuing invoices in line with contract terms
- Managing daily receipting and following up outstanding payments where required
- Assisting with month-end reconciliations and reporting
- Maintaining accurate records within the accounting system
- Liaising with internal and external stakeholders across multiple business sites
- Supporting the finance team with ad hoc accounts receivable tasks as needed
